I got the NWA title for a wedding gift. The belt is great and is the best belt they made. I have friends that have many of the other belts and they even agree the NWA belt is the best.
It will be a little hard to find since it's not made anymore and the prices people ask for it on e-bay are kinda high.
The plates are shiney (unlike some of the WCW and WWF plates I have seen). The flags are all really nice and the globe dome is very nice. The belt itself is also great as it is not just one sold piece of "leather". It has folds built into it so that you may wear it without cracking the leather.
